Charge-M8 Unveils New Range of EV Charger Protection Barriers

EV charging experts, Charge-M8, are thrilled to announce their latest line of EV charger protection barriers designed to shield valuable EV charging units from unintended vehicle collisions, while also complying with UK safety standards.

This innovative collection features six distinct products, including steel quad/tri post barriers, steel U barriers available in both narrow and wide dimensions, and rubber wheel stops offered in two sizes, with prices ranging from a mere £29.97 to £268.97.

Charge-M8 makes safeguarding your costly and essential EV charging installations more straightforward than ever. In addition to selling these products, they also provide an installation and securing service, ensuring that your EV charging facilities are well-protected and remain secure for the foreseeable future.

According to the BS IET Wiring Regulations 18th Edition codes AG2-AG3, reinforced protection is mandated for areas with a medium or high risk of impact. The IET’s EV Charging Equipment Installation Code of Practice requires that equipment in public spaces must be shielded from impacts of at least AG2 severity, as specified in BS76741 (18th Edition). Charge-M8 advises using robust tyre stops as an initial safeguard, complemented by impact barriers as a secondary measure for instances where tyre stops are bypassed or when a vehicle’s overhang goes beyond their protective range.

Julian Smith, CEO of Charge-M8 said: “Since launching Charge-M8 impact protection range we’ve received an overwhelming response from the trade and will expand the range further throughout 2024.  The high quality of the products and speed of delivery are the two areas that have been praised in particular which is very pleasing to hear.
The product range came into existence when we were trying to source a consistent supply of impact barriers and tyre stops at an acceptable cost. After numerous cancelled orders, mostly due to incorrect stock availability it seemed like the obvious thing to do was to source our own range and as well as using these for our own projects, offer the range to the wider EV installer network. We’re pleased to be able to help and give peace of mind that their assets are well protected.”

Although designed with EV safeguarding in mind, these barriers are versatile enough for a wide array of applications, such as delineating areas or establishing safety zones, making them ideal for warehouses, storage areas, manufacturing sites, and parking lots.
